What it is, How it works

Hair testing is regarded as an effective means for identifying drug and alcohol consumption. It offers an extended historical record of drug and alcohol use by embedding biomarkers within the hair strand fibers. When gathered close to the scalp, hair offers a detection span of up to around 3 months for alcohol and various drugs. Collecting hair is straightforward, moderately resistant to tampering, and simple for transporting.

A sample measuring 1.5 inches and comprising about 200 hair strands (resembling a #2 pencil in size) near the scalp yields 100mg of hair, which is the optimal amount for screening and validation. For tests like EtG, add-ons, or those exceeding 10 panels, a 150mg specimen is advised. We suggest using a jeweler's scale for accurate weighing. If scalp hair can't be obtained, an equivalent amount of body hair can be used. References to head hair pertain solely to scalp hair, while body hair encompasses all other forms (such as facial, axillary, etc.).

Process Overview

The process in the lab for processing a drug test outcome consists of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ning covers the initial phase where a sample gets processed into the lab's system. This phase verifies proper sealing and shipping of the sample, assigns a random L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and completes any additional data entries not supplied by an electronic chain of custody system.

Screening involves a preliminary rapid assessment for substances of abuse. While it effectively rules out drug usage for most samples affordably, a positive screen must be confirmed to hold up legally. Samples that test positive in Screening require further confirmation.

Should a sample test positive in the Screening, more hair is extracted from the original sample for preparation in the Extraction phase. In this phase, drugs are drawn from hair at concentrations much lower compared to other methods (such as urine or oral fluid), making hair drug screening notably challenging.

Positive screening outcomes undergo confirmation via G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S. All samples testing positive are cleaned before further confirmation if needed. The comprehensive laboratory workflow from Accessioning to Confirmation undergoes reviews under the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air directive along with accreditation to ISO / IEC 17025 standards.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Long detection window: Hair tests can reveal drug usage for up to 90 days, unlike urine tests that have a shorter window.
  • Difficulty to cheat: It's significantly challenging to manipulate a hair drug test, thus ensuring more reliable results.
  • Provides historical data: It provides a timeline of drug use over time, not just recent usage.

Limitations:

  • Cannot detect recent use: Drugs take roughly 5-7 days to become identifiable in hair.
  • Cost: Hair tests generally incur higher costs than other testing methods.
  • Variations in results: Drug metabolite concentrations in hair can be influenced by factors like hair color and personal growth rates.

Note: Despite being known as "hair follicle tests", the test itself evaluates the hair strands rather than the follicles beneath the scalp.

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
Yes. If the donor's head hair is too short or unavailable, body hair may be collected as an alternative. The collector will document the source of the sample. This allows testing even for individuals with recently cut or shaved head hair.
